FIA confirms unchanged 12-round Formula 2 calendar

Formula 2’s 12-round 2019 calendar has been published by the FIA’s World Motor Sport Council.

The championship will begin in Bahrain next March and conclude in Abu Dhabi at the start of December, in conjunction with Formula 1’s season finale.

Between those events the series will visit Azerbaijan, Spain, Monaco, France, Austria, Britain, Hungary, Belgium, Italy and Russia.

It is the same 12-round calendar as in 2018.

The new-for-2019 Formula 3 championship will join Formula 2 at eight of those 12 rounds, skipping Bahrain, Azerbaijan, Monaco and Abu Dhabi.

It means the tertiary series will commence in Spain next May and come to a close at September’s Russia round.

Formula 3's predecessor, GP3, had previously concluded alongside Formula 1 and Formula 2 in Abu Dhabi, which takes place a week after the Macau Grand Prix, whose 2019 category line-up has yet to be determined.

Formula 2 2019 calendar:

Date
Country
Circuit
29-31 March Bahrain Sakhir
26-28 April Azerbaijan Baku
10-12 May* Spain Barcelona
23-25 May Monaco Monaco
21-23 June* France Le Castellet
28-30 June* Austria Spielberg
12-14 July* Great Britain Silverstone
2-4 August* Hungary Budapest
30 August – 1 September* Belgium Spa‐Francorchamps
6-8 September* Italy Monza
27-29 September* Russia Sochi
29 November – 1 December Abu Dhabi Yas Marina

*FIA Formula 3 will also race at this event
